Telethon airs this weekend Some background, please, on Jerry Lewis and his Labor Day telethon. Comedian and actor Jerry Lewis, now 83, has been doing the Muscular Dystrophy Association telethon on Labor Day weekend for 44 years. The show, which is this weekend in Las Vegas, is televised on about 180 stations across the country from 9 p.m. Sunday until 6 p.m. Monday. In the Tampa Bay area, it will be shown on the ABC affiliate, WFTS-Ch. 28. More than 40 million people are expected to watch at least part of the show. Last year, a record $65 million was raised, and since its inception, the telethon has raised more than $1.5 billion for research, health care and support services such as advocacy and education. Lewis’ interest in raising money to support muscular dystrophy research began in 1952 when a co-worker on the Colgate Comedy Hour convinced him it was a good cause. The Jerry Lewis MDA Telethon (also known as The Jerry Lewis MDA Labor Day Telethon) is hosted by actor and comedian, Jerry Lewis to raise money for the Muscular Dystrophy Association (MDA). It has been held annually since 1966. As of 2007, the telethon had raised $1.46 billion since its inception.[1] It is held on Labor Day weekend, starting on the Sunday evening preceding Labor Day and continuing until late Monday afternoon, syndicated to approximately 190 television stations throughout the United States. In recent years, the telethon generally runs live for 21 hours, from 9PM ET to 6PM ET, though actual start and end times may vary by station. MDA calls its network of participating stations the “Love Network”. The show has originated from Las Vegas for 23 of the 40 years it has aired.
